Ambulance Inflation Factor Increase

Ambulance Inflation Factor at 8.7%

January 16, 2023

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S) set the new Ambulance Inflation Factor (AIF) at 8.7% for the calendar year 2023. Ambulance services will receive this additional Medicare reimbursement now for ambulance transportation. This is the highest annual ambulance inflation factor since the current fee schedule from 2002. It’s also the largest year-over-year increase on […]

ET3 Reimbursement-Texas Medicaid Approved

Texas Medicaid Approved ET3 Model as a Covered Benefit

January 9, 2023

A new Medicaid benefit changes the emergency services landscape in Texas. Here’s why it matters. The Emergency Triage, Treat, and Transport (ET3) model, which started in 2019, pays EMS agencies for treatment and transports beyond the emergency room – such as in place or to alternate destinations.
